diff --git a/svelte/src/admin_panel/AbuseReport.svelte b/svelte/src/admin_panel/AbuseReport.svelte index 95543f7..a730777 100644 --- a/svelte/src/admin_panel/AbuseReport.svelte +++ b/svelte/src/admin_panel/AbuseReport.svelte @@ -59,6 +59,7 @@ let set_status = async (action, report_type) => { +
diff --git a/svelte/src/file_viewer/BottomBanner.svelte b/svelte/src/file_viewer/BottomBanner.svelte index 633de76..4996e3b 100644 --- a/svelte/src/file_viewer/BottomBanner.svelte +++ b/svelte/src/file_viewer/BottomBanner.svelte @@ -6,16 +6,13 @@ let ad_type = "" onMount(() => { // 20% pixeldrain socials // 20% reviews - // 10% battle cry - // 40% patreon + // 60% patreon let rand = Math.random() if (rand < 0.2) { ad_type = "socials" } else if (rand < 0.4) { ad_type = "reviews" - } else if (rand < 0.5) { - ad_type = "slava_ukraini" } else { ad_type = "patreon_support" } diff --git a/svelte/src/file_viewer/FileViewer.svelte b/svelte/src/file_viewer/FileViewer.svelte index 50bc2e0..5941551 100644 --- a/svelte/src/file_viewer/FileViewer.svelte +++ b/svelte/src/file_viewer/FileViewer.svelte @@ -3,7 +3,6 @@ import { onMount, tick } from "svelte"; import { copy_text } from "../util/Util.svelte"; import { file_struct, list_struct, file_set_href } from "./FileUtilities.svelte"; import Modal from "../util/Modal.svelte"; -import PixeldrainLogo from "../util/PixeldrainLogo.svelte"; import DetailsWindow from "./DetailsWindow.svelte"; import FilePreview from "./viewers/FilePreview.svelte"; import ListNavigator from "./ListNavigator.svelte"; @@ -11,7 +10,6 @@ import FileStats from "./FileStats.svelte"; import EditWindow from "./EditWindow.svelte"; import EmbedWindow from "./EmbedWindow.svelte"; import ReportWindow from "./ReportWindow.svelte"; -import IntroPopup from "./IntroPopup.svelte"; import BottomBanner from "./BottomBanner.svelte"; import Sharebar from "./Sharebar.svelte"; import GalleryView from "./GalleryView.svelte"; @@ -21,6 +19,7 @@ import LoadingIndicator from "../util/LoadingIndicator.svelte"; import TransferLimit from "./TransferLimit.svelte"; import ListStats from "./ListStats.svelte"; import ListUpdater from "./ListUpdater.svelte"; +import HomeButton from "./HomeButton.svelte"; let loading = true let embedded = false @@ -34,7 +33,6 @@ let is_list = false let list_downloadable = false let file_preview -let button_home let list_navigator let list_shuffle = false let toggle_shuffle = () => { @@ -85,7 +83,6 @@ let report_window let report_visible = false let embed_window let embed_visible = false -let skyscraper_visible = false onMount(() => { let viewer_data = window.viewer_data @@ -400,14 +397,7 @@ const keyboard_event = evt => { {/if} - - - +
{#if list.title !== ""}{list.title}
{/if} @@ -580,7 +570,6 @@ const keyboard_event = evt => { class:checkers={!custom_background} class:custom_background={!!custom_background} class:toolbar_visible - class:skyscraper_visible > {#if view === "file"} { - {#if ads_enabled} - - {/if} - {#if is_list && list.can_edit} @@ -697,14 +682,6 @@ const keyboard_event = evt => { .headerbar > button > .icon { font-size: 1.6em; } -.headerbar > .button_home::after { - content: "pixeldrain"; -} -@media (max-width: 600px) { - .headerbar > .button_home::after { - content: "pd"; - } -} /* File preview area (row 3) */ .file_preview_row { @@ -729,7 +706,6 @@ const keyboard_event = evt => { border: 2px solid var(--separator); } .file_preview.toolbar_visible { left: 8.2em; } -.file_preview.skyscraper_visible { right: 160px; } .file_preview.custom_background { background-size: cover; background-position: center; diff --git a/svelte/src/file_viewer/HomeButton.svelte b/svelte/src/file_viewer/HomeButton.svelte new file mode 100644 index 0000000..ea957dc --- /dev/null +++ b/svelte/src/file_viewer/HomeButton.svelte @@ -0,0 +1,41 @@ + + +{#if window.user.username === ""} + + + +{:else} + + + + {window.user.username} + + +{/if} + +